During Grand Central Terminal's Parade of Trains anniversary celebration, Metro-North P32AC-DM 202 (built in 1995) found itself next to former New York Central observation lounge-sleeper car Hickory Creek. The Hickory Creek, built in 1948, spent almost two decades departing from GCT as one of the tail cars on New York Central's premier passenger train, the New York-to-Chicago 20th Century Limited.
